Output 34a07b23ebd0ad91b3f5dcf91c2e98febf44171544ce325c5e7debde0d262309:1

value
23404031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0bbc03cc30237d4f4ce082d6acb4766a2cf0498 OP_EQUAL
address
MNZ3GHYvzF1HNaqUDqg2T6xGK3p9eZpB67
transaction
34a07b23ebd0ad91b3f5dcf91c2e98febf44171544ce325c5e7debde0d262309
spent
true